Motorola makes fun of Apple iPhone 5 Maps application

Apple came with the idea to switch from Google Maps to their own native Maps application, probably because their really trying to get Google out of their lives for good, however this Maps decision is costing Apple dearly and Motorola Mobility is taking advantage of the situation making fun of Cupertino-based company.

Motorola is promoting its newest Droid RAZR M edge-to-edge display phone and the Google Maps app in a campaign that shows how bad the Apple Maps app is.

“Looking for 315 E 15th in Manhattan? Google Maps on DROID RAZR M will get you there & not #iLost in Brooklyn.”
